About N-[(5,6-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ydronaphthalen-1-yl)methyl]-4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-2-amine
N-[(5,6-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ydronaphthalen-1-yl)methyl]-4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-2-amine (PubChem CID 13340029) has the molecular formula C24H31NO3
and a molecular weight of 381.52 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is N-[(5,6-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ydronaphthalen-1-yl)methyl]-4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-2-amine.

What is the SMILES notation for N-[(5,6-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ydronaphthalen-1-yl)methyl]-4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-2-amine?
The canonical SMILES for N-[(5,6-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ydronaphthalen-1-yl)methyl]-4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-2-amine is COc1ccc(CCC(C)NCC2=CCCc3c2ccc(OC)c3OC)cc1.
What is the InChIKey of N-[(5,6-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ydronaphthalen-1-yl)methyl]-4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-2-amine?
The InChIKey is QUKHOWOPRGSJNR-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C24H31NO3/c1-17(8-9-18-10-12-20(26-2)13-11-18)25-16-19-6-5-7-22-21(19)14-15-23(27-3)24(22)28-4/h6,10-15,17,25H,5,7-9,16H2,1-4H3.
What are the key properties of N-[(5,6-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ydronaphthalen-1-yl)methyl]-4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-2-amine?
N-[(5,6-dimethoxy-3,4-dihydronaphthalen-1-yl)methyl]-4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-2-amine has a molecular weight of 381.52 g/mol, XLogP of 4.65, 9 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 4 hydrogen bond acceptors.
